当前页面:
在线文档首页 >
JBoss JBPM 3.1.3 API 英文版文档
VariableContainer (jbpm-3.1.3) - JBoss JBPM 3.1.3 API 英文版文档
org.jbpm.context.exe
Class VariableContainer
java.lang.Object
org.jbpm.context.exe.VariableContainer
- All Implemented Interfaces:
- java.io.Serializable
- Direct Known Subclasses:
- TaskInstance, TokenVariableMap
public abstract class VariableContainer
- extends java.lang.Object
- implements java.io.Serializable
- See Also:
- Serialized Form
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
variableInstances
protected java.util.Map variableInstances
VariableContainer
public VariableContainer()
getParentVariableContainer
protected abstract VariableContainer getParentVariableContainer()
getToken
public abstract Token getToken()
getVariable
public java.lang.Object getVariable(java.lang.String name)
setVariable
public void setVariable(java.lang.String name,
java.lang.Object value)
hasVariable
public boolean hasVariable(java.lang.String name)
deleteVariable
public void deleteVariable(java.lang.String name)
addVariables
public void addVariables(java.util.Map variables)
getVariables
public java.util.Map getVariables()
getVariablesLocally
public java.util.Map getVariablesLocally()
hasVariableLocally
public boolean hasVariableLocally(java.lang.String name)
getVariableLocally
public java.lang.Object getVariableLocally(java.lang.String name)
deleteVariableLocally
public void deleteVariableLocally(java.lang.String name)
setVariableLocally
public void setVariableLocally(java.lang.String name,
java.lang.Object value)
getVariableInstance
public VariableInstance getVariableInstance(java.lang.String name)
getVariableInstances
public java.util.Map getVariableInstances()
addVariableInstance
public void addVariableInstance(VariableInstance variableInstance)
deleteVariableInstance
public void deleteVariableInstance(java.lang.String name)
getContextInstance
public ContextInstance getContextInstance()
getUpdatedVariableContainers
public static java.util.Collection getUpdatedVariableContainers(ProcessInstance processInstance)
Version : jbpm-3.1.3